http.Client और http.Transport का उपयोग करके HTTP अनुरोधों के लिए हेडर सेट करना
कस्टम नेटवर्क कॉन्फ़िगरेशन का उपयोग करके HTTP अनुरोध करने के संदर्भ में, वहां अनुरोध पर विशिष्ट शीर्षलेख सेट करने की आवश्यकता हो सकती है। इस मामले में, http.NewRequest का उपयोग करके एक नया HTTP अनुरोध बनाते समय हेडर सेट किया जा सकता है।
एक बार अनुरोध बन जाने के बाद, आप req.Header ऑब्जेक्ट का उपयोग करके हेडर सेट कर सकते हैं, जहां req आपका HTTP है अनुरोध वस्तु. विशिष्ट हेडर मान सेट विधि का उपयोग करके सेट किए जा सकते हैं, जैसे कि req.Header.Set('name', 'value').
अब, कस्टम हेडर सेटिंग्स के साथ अनुरोध निष्पादित करने के लिए एक विशिष्ट का उपयोग भी करें नेटवर्क इंटरफ़ेस और ट्रांसपोर्ट कॉन्फ़िगरेशन:
req, err := http.NewRequest("GET", "https://www.whatismyip.com/", nil)
if err != nil {
// handle error
}
req.Header.Set("name", "value")
resp, err := client.Do(req)
if err != nil {
// handle error
}
// Handle response as per the provided sample code
अस्वीकरण: उपलब्ध कराए गए सभी संसाधन आंशिक रूप से इंटरनेट से हैं। यदि आपके कॉपीराइट या अन्य अधिकारों और हितों का कोई उल्लंघन होता है, तो कृपया विस्तृत कारण बताएं और कॉपीराइट या अधिकारों और हितों का प्रमाण प्रदान करें और फिर इसे ईमेल पर भेजें: [email protected] हम इसे आपके लिए यथाशीघ्र संभालेंगे।
Copyright© 2022 湘ICP备2022001581号-3